Downtown Boise, Boise, ID Local Guide

How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Downtown Boise?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Downtown Boise Studio Apartments | $1,572 | $1,215 | $2,331 |
| Downtown Boise 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,335 | $1,095 | $3,526 |
| Downtown Boise 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,976 | $1,395 | $6,620 |
| Downtown Boise 3 Bedroom Apartments | $5,493 | $2,601 | $9,482 |

Cheapest Available Downtown Boise Apartments for Rent
 The cheapest available apartment rental in the Downtown Boise area of Boise, ID is a Studio unit found at The Gem priced from $1,245. The Lucy (Inactive) has the second lowest priced unit, which is a Studio apartment currently listed from $1,358. Here are the most affordable Downtown Boise apartments for rent in Boise, ID:
| Apartment Listing | Model Name | Bed/Bath | Priced From |
|---|---|---|---|
| The Gem | Studio C | Studio,1BA | $1,245 |
| The Lucy (Inactive) | Studio with Ori 383 sqft | Studio,1BA | $1,358 |
| Broadstone Saratoga | Franklin | Studio,1BA | $1,612 |
| Riverline | 1x1A | 1BR,1BA | $1,650 |
| The Fowler Apartments | 1BR x 1BA | 1BR,1BA | $1,719 |
| Whitewater Park | One Bedroom, One Bath | 1BR,1BA | $1,896 |
| The Watercooler Apartments | 2BD x 2BA | 2BR,2BA | $1,960 |
| Arthur | S2 | Studio,1BA | $1,995 |
| Hearth on Broad | B2 | 2BR,2BA | $2,521 |
